Basic Steps in the Import Export Process
1. Market Research and Partner Search
The first and most important step is to research your target market and find reliable partners. You need to identify market needs, competitors, and the import/export regulations of that country. Finding reputable partners will help you minimize risks during the transaction process.
2. Preparing Documents and Customs Procedures
This step requires high accuracy. You need to prepare all necessary documents such as sales contracts, invoices, packing lists, shipping documents, etc. Incorrect customs procedures can lead to delays or penalties.
3. Goods Transportation
There are many forms of goods transportation such as sea, air, and land. You need to choose the appropriate transportation method based on the type of goods, time, and cost. Choosing a reputable transporter is also important to ensure that the goods are transported safely and on schedule.
4. International Payments
International payments require carefulness and the choice of appropriate payment methods to ensure safety for both parties. Common payment methods include L/C (Letter of Credit), T/T (Telegraphic Transfer), D/P (Documents against Payment), D/A (Documents against Acceptance).
5. Risk Management
In import and export, risks always exist. You need to have a risk management plan, such as transportation risks, payment risks, goods quality risks, etc.
